The government experts disagree with your statement about development not causing sinkholes. On page 3 of its booklest, cleverly titled "Sinkholes", the Southwest Florida Water Management District states: "Increased numbers of sinkholes can generally be attributed to changing or loading of the earth's surface with development such as retention ponds, buildings, changes in drainage patterns, heavy traffic, drilling vibration or sudden or gradual decline in groundwater levels....Urban construction, coupled with limestone depths of less than 200 feet, contributes to many of the modern sinkholes." This would seem to be common sense.
